FR MESTERBYGG AS is registered as a limited company in Flesberg, Buskerud with organisation number 935204399. The business is classified under construction of residential and non-residential buildings (NACE 41.000). The company was incorporated in 2025. Registered share capital is NOK 30,000, divided into 300 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Tømrer- og snekkervirksomhet og alt som står i forbindelse med dette, samt salg av andre tjenester innen bolig- og hytteservice.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2025 financial year, show NOK 1.2m in revenue and NOK 35,000 in operating profit.
